Accountants record, classify, and summarise financial transactions to produce accurate reports, ensure regulatory compliance, and support strategic decision-making. The role spans from bookkeeping and tax preparation to financial analysis and audit. CPA-qualified accountants are in demand globally across public accounting firms, corporate finance teams, government agencies, and non-profits. The profession offers strong job security, clear certification pathways, and a natural progression into finance leadership, CFO, and advisory roles.
Junior Accountant or Bookkeeper. Handles data entry, bank reconciliations, and basic reporting under supervision.
Accountant or Senior Associate. Leads month-end close, prepares financial statements, and manages a specific area (AP, AR, tax, or audit).
Senior Accountant or Accounting Manager. Oversees the close process, manages junior staff, and liaises with auditors and tax advisors.
Controller, Finance Director, or CFO track. Responsible for all accounting operations, financial reporting, compliance, and strategic financial planning.
